Porsche Cup of America Hits New Orleans, Feb. 22-24

By -

PCA NOLA Cup 2019

It’s beer, beads, and burning rubber as PCA NOLA Cup 2019 race weekend coincides with NASA competitions and Mardi Gras.

Race fans are in for a triple dose of fun the weekend of February 22 to 24, 2019. That’s when the Porsche Club of America (PCA) comes to the Big Easy with their PCA NOLA Cup 2019. The event happens at NOLA Motorsports Park in New Orleans, Louisiana.

The weekend will be a shared event with the NOLA National Auto Sport Association (NASA) region. Included over the three days are PCA races, NASA competitions, a NASA High Performance Driving Event, and NASA Time Trial. The PCA practice sessions and races will be in their own run groups separate from the NASA groups. They will be using the 2.75-mile configuration with the “esses.”

Mardi Gras also begins the weekend of PCA NOLA Cup 2019. The beer and beads revelry continues through Tuesday, March 5. So after you’re done watching the races, stick around town to enjoy more of the Big Easy.

Friday’s schedule of PCA NOLA Cup includes a fun race and a 75-minute Enduro points race. A party that night will be hosted by NOLA Sport Porsche Specialists and Quirt Racing of Cresson, Texas. Saturday’s itinerary features two sprint points races, followed by the awards dinner that evening at the NOLA MP Events Center. And on Sunday, fans will be able to watch the Australian Pursuit Race followed by the victory celebration. Performance Stop will be on site over the weekend with driver safety equipment, instructor/student/pit gear requirements, track car consumables, and supplies.

Sponsors of PCA NOLA Cup 2019 are NOLA Sport Porsche Specialists, Quirt Racing, and Brian Harris Porsche of Baton Rouge.
